French Jewish DJ sues after activists disrupt gig: lawyer

A French Jewish DJ who has become embroiled in the latest cultural boycott campaign linked to Israel's war in Gaza has filed a complaint against campaigners who disrupted one of her appearances last weekend, her lawyer said Thursday.

Barbara Butch, previously best known for her controversial appearance at the opening ceremony of the 2024 Paris Olympics, was forced off stage during a set in the eastern city of Grenoble on Saturday.

Butch filed criminal complaints in Grenoble and Paris alleging incitement to hatred and violence, assault, and obstruction of artistic freedom among other complaints, her lawyer Audrey Msellati said.

"I wouldn't wish on anyone -- not even on my worst enemy -- to feel or go through what I went through last Saturday," the 45-year-old told Franceinfo radio on Thursday morning.

Campaigners and local elected figures from the hard-left France Unbowed political party had targeted her over her decision to sign a petition in support of an abandoned attempt to widen the criminal definition of antisemitism in France.

Critics saw the proposed law as seeking to muzzle campaigners who speak out in favour of Palestinian rights and against Israel's war in Gaza.

Butch was also falsely accused of appearing at an LGBTQ Pride event in Tel Aviv last year.

The campaign against her has caused unease even among supporters of a cultural boycott of Israel and has raised questions about who is a legitimate target for such action.

"Defending the rights of the Palestinian people is an urgent, legitimate, and necessary struggle," a petition signed by 300 leading cultural figures in support of Butch said this week.

"But it cannot justify spreading unfounded accusations against a person because of their identity or supposed affiliations, or even because of their opinions."

- Boycott campaign -

Butch, a vocal campaigner for the LGBTQ community, has said she was subjected to verbal abuse as well as being targeted by objects thrown onto the stage in Grenoble.

She has said she regrets signing the petition in support of the so-called Yadan bill on antisemitism, which was withdrawn earlier this year after major protests and criticism from the United Nations.

Her cancelled concert follows protests against dissident Israeli filmmaker Nadav Lapid appearing at a festival in Marseille in June.

Lapid, an outspoken government critic who lives in France, withdrew from the festival as a result.

Supporters called the campaign against him an "intellectual failure" in a petition.

Butch shot to fame -- and was subject to an intense online cyberbullying campaign -- after the Paris Olympics opening ceremony.

She performed alongside dancers and drag queens in a scene that was reminiscent of depictions of the Last Supper, the final meal that Jesus is said to have shared with his apostles.
